The best of both worlds minutes from Wagga
Welcome to Rosehill, a delightful rural lifestyle parcel located 11km northeast of Wagga Wagga, offering 50.6 hectares (125ac) of prime rural land. This property is a rare find, combining a wonderfully maintained and loved home with highly productive agricultural land, all within minutes of Fitzmaurice Street, Wagga Wagga.
The four-bedroom, three-bathroom brick homestead, built in 1984, is designed both comfort and entertainment in mind. The home is light and airy with large windows in all living and bedrooms. The family room features, slate flooring, an open fireplace and a bar, making it perfect for hosting gatherings. The kitchen, has electric cooking and a walk-in pantry, opens to the comfortable family room, while the formal dining and living rooms provide additional areas for relaxation.
The bedrooms are well-appointed, the main has an ensuite and walk in robe, two other bedrooms have built in robes. The family bathroom has a separate toilet and the third bathroom is accessed from the laundry. Outside, a paved verandah surrounds the home, leading into a low-maintenance, established garden with paved outdoor entertaining area. The home is equipped with slow combustion heating in the living room, evaporative cooling throughout, and reverse cycle heating and cooling, ensuring comfort in all seasons. Solar panels on the roof provide for economic power and there is solar heated hot water.
For the agricultural enthusiast, Rosehill is a dream come true. The property has a mains connection, one dam and rainwater tanks. The property is rated as 96% arable, having been continuously cropped with canola, wheat, and lupins over the past decade under a share farming arrangement. Currently, the property is a wheat stubble from 2024, purchasers will be able to decide for themselves what's to be produced in 2025. This recent history of successful cropping underscores the land's fertility and potential for continued agricultural productivity.
Rosehill is well-equipped with farming infrastructure with cattle yards, machinery and hay sheds, a powered workshop with storage bays, and an older-style shed with space for three vehicles and a small workshop.
